HOW WHAT IS MD5 TECHNOLOGY CAN SAVE YOU TIME, STRESS, AND MONEY.

How what is md5 technology can Save You Time, Stress, and Money.

How what is md5 technology can Save You Time, Stress, and Money.

Blog Article

Although the cybersecurity landscape is constantly birthing superior and a lot more robust ways of ensuring details protection, MD5 remains, as both equally a tale of growth and certainly one of warning.

The ultimate sixty four bits in the padded concept depict the length of the first concept in bits, making certain that the total duration in the padded message is often a a number of of 512 bits.

In 2004 it absolutely was shown that MD5 is not collision-resistant.[27] Therefore, MD5 just isn't suitable for purposes like SSL certificates or digital signatures that rely upon this assets for digital security. Researchers Furthermore identified extra critical flaws in MD5, and described a feasible collision attack—a technique to create a pair of inputs for which MD5 produces equivalent checksums.

After you log on, you frequently deliver messages and documents. But in these cases, you'll be able to’t see Should the information are corrupted. The MD5 hash algorithm can verify that for you.

Later on it was also discovered to generally be possible to construct collisions amongst two documents with individually decided on prefixes. This method was Employed in the generation on the rogue CA certification in 2008.

MD5 is also Employed in password hashing, where by it can be applied to transform plaintext passwords into cryptographically secure hashes which might be saved in the database for afterwards read more comparison.

All the attacker ought to produce two colliding documents is a template file having a 128-byte block of knowledge, aligned on the sixty four-byte boundary, that may be improved freely through the collision-getting algorithm. An example MD5 collision, While using the two messages differing in 6 bits, is: d131dd02c5e6eec4 693d9a0698aff95c 2fcab58712467eab 4004583eb8fb7f89

Inspite of its acceptance, MD5 has long been discovered to get liable to various varieties of assaults, for instance collision and pre-graphic attacks, that diminish its usefulness being a protection Software. Consequently, it's now getting replaced by safer hash algorithms like SHA-two and SHA-three.

Checksum Verification: The MD5 hash algorithm validates file integrity during transmission or storage. Buyers can determine data corruption or tampering by evaluating the MD5 hash of the been given file to the anticipated hash.

Antivirus courses use md5 to compute a hash value of documents which are regarded to become destructive. These hash values are stored in the database, and once the antivirus scans a file, it calculates its hash benefit and compares it with the ones from the database.

MD5 is effective by having an enter (concept) and following a number of methods to mix and compress the info, combining it with constants and inner state variables, in the long run creating a fixed-dimensions output hash.

The MD5 (information-digest algorithm 5) hashing algorithm is usually a cryptographic protocol accustomed to authenticate messages and digital signatures. The leading reason of MD5 is always to validate which the receiver of a concept or file is finding the very same information and facts that was despatched.

// Initialize hash value for this chunk: var int A := a0 var int B := b0 var int C := c0 var int D := d0

Regardless of its initial intention, MD5 is thought to be broken because of its vulnerability to various assault vectors. Collisions, where by two distinctive inputs deliver exactly the same hash value, may be generated with relative relieve using modern computational ability. Therefore, MD5 is no more advised for cryptographic functions, such as password storage.

Report this page